Unai Emery Names Two Arsenal Players Who Want Iwobi Picked In Starting Line-Up

Arsenal coach Unai Emery has revealed two left-footed players in his squad, Nacho Monreal and Sead Kolasinac, want Alex Iwobi to be named in the starting line-up for every game.
The Nigeria international, who has started 16 out of 28 matches in the Premier League this season, has often been made the scapegoat by a section of the fans when things are not working out for the Gunners but Emery has insisted the winger is an important player in the squad.
''When I ask Nacho Monreal and Send Kolasinac who is the player who you feel better on the pitch when he is playing, they say to us: Iwobi," said Emery, according to The Independent
"It is because Iwobi can open space on the overlap for them.
"So I think Iwobi is giving a lot for us. We want to play and we want to create our philosophy and I think for that Iwobi is important.

''But he needs to carry on improving and he knows that the situation can still improve.''
Iwobi passed a fitness test ahead of Wednesday's 5-1 rout of Bournemouth and replaced KolaĊĦinac 11 minutes after the restart.
